Today is the grand opening of The Commons, which is a community space in Boerum Hill that will be offering a variety of donation-based yoga, including prenatal. They are offering prenatal yoga classes (Monday, Wednesday and Friday from 10am – 11:30am) as well as general classes (vinyasa, sivananda, and gentle). Some of the classes take place on their rooftop, and even more lovely sounding- at sunset. Their prenatal teachers are certified yoga instructors who have received training in prenatal yoga teaching through the Prenatal Yoga Center teacher training program in New York City. Mats, blocks and blankets are available.
Dharma Yoga Brooklyn opened last month with their donation based classes in Park Slope. They offer classes at all levels, including meditation.
So what exactly does donation based mean? Students can pay what they can afford. Suggested donation is $10 at The Commons , but “any amount is greatly appreciated.”
